Microsoft Examines Basic Authentication’s Role in BEC Attacks In late 2019, Microsoft announced their intent to remove basic authentication from Exchange Online protocols. Though for many organizations using Microsoft 365, a combination of basic authentication and connection protocols, like POP3 and IMAP4, is still standard practice for accessing Exchange Online mailboxes.
